Management DLCI 1 and 2 (DLCI 1 and 2)

Enter the management data link connection identifiers (DLCIs).
These DLCIs are used to carry management traffic to and from the
network.
Range: 16 to 1007.

Maximum PVC Count

Set the maximum number of PVCs that the TSU IQ+ will monitor
for statistical information. This value determines the amount of
history intervals available for storage. To get the maximum amount
of statistical history storage, set this value equal to the number of
PVCs assigned to the frame relay port. A smaller value increases
history interval count but puts some of the PVC statistics into the
unknown category.
Range: 1 to 100.
